A Career Advancement Programme in Humanitarian Security Project Implementation provides professionals with the critical skills and knowledge to excel in this dynamic field. The programme focuses on practical application, enhancing participants' ability to manage complex projects while ensuring safety and security within challenging environments.
Learning outcomes typically include improved project management techniques specifically tailored for humanitarian settings, enhanced risk assessment and mitigation strategies, and a deeper understanding of security protocols and best practices for humanitarian aid delivery. Participants will gain proficiency in conflict sensitivity, stakeholder engagement, and the effective use of technology for security in the field.
The duration of such programmes varies, often ranging from several weeks to several months, depending on the depth of coverage and the experience level of the participants. Some programmes may offer flexible learning modules to accommodate busy schedules while maintaining a rigorous curriculum.
